Course objectives
Main objectives can be summarized as follows: the basic knowledge about massage; to delineate the major differences between classical and sports massage; to understand the physiologic process of organism in the course massage; to understand the chronological process of massage;
Syllabus
  • History of the massage
  • Types of the massage
  • Total and local reactions of the massage
  • Indication and contra-indication of the massage
  • Hygiene of the massage
  • Massage means
  • Massage - procedure
